Comprehending Limited Liability Companies

Limited Liability Corporations, also called LLCs, constitute a common category of corporate structure in the USA. They merge the adaptability of a partnership with the limited liability benefits associated with a company. This means that proprietors, known as shareholders, are not liable for the financial obligations and responsibilities of the LLC, safeguarding their personal assets. This arrangement is particularly advantageous for small enterprises seeking to mitigate exposures while benefiting from operational versatility.

Forming an Limited Liability Company involves registering with the appropriate state governing bodies. Every state has its own specific requirements and procedures for forming an LLC, which may include submitting Organizational Articles and paying a filing fee. One of the benefits of an Limited Liability Company is that it can be managed directly by its members or by selected administrators, providing options in management and operational framework. Moreover, Limited Liability Companies allow for pass-through taxation, meaning that profits and deficits can be reported on the individual tax filings of the members, streamlining the tax considerations for the business.

Methods to Conduct an LLC Inquiry

Conducting a LLC inquiry is an important step for individuals seeking to gather data about a limited liability company. Begin, with identifying the state in which the LLC is incorporated, since every state keeps its own registry of companies. You can retrieve this information typically via the state's Secretary of State site or the appropriate state business registry. Many of these websites offer a convenient search tool where you can input the LLC title to get details about its current status, date of formation, and registered agent.

Once you have visited the appropriate state website, you can execute an LLC company search. Make sure that you input the exact name of the LLC for the most accurate results. In certain instances, different forms of the name may also aid you identify the appropriate entity, especially if the LLC operates under various DBAs. The search findings usually display key data, including the registered address and any documents or changes pertaining to the LLC's standing.

If you need to execute a business entity inquiry across several states or require information beyond state databases, consider using third-party business data platforms. These services compile data from different state registries, providing a more thorough overview of LLCs across the United States. They often feature capabilities like historical data on the business, related businesses, and even finance details if they are available, making them a beneficial resource for those conducting comprehensive research on corporate entities.

Frequent Errors in LLC Investigations

One frequent mistake people make during an LLC investigation is failing to check the correct title of the company. Many companies may have similar or nearly identical titles, leading to misunderstanding. It is crucial to ensure that the search includes any different variations or abbreviations used in the company title. Relying solely on a fragmentary name can lead to inaccurate information and a misunderstanding of which company is being searched.

Another error occurs when individuals overlook the significance of the region in which the LLC is registered. Various regions have varying laws and rules regarding LLCs. People may conduct a company entity investigation without indicating the state, which can yield irrelevant findings. Always ensure that the search is refined to the correct region to obtain relevant information related to the Limited Liability Company in focus.

Lastly, many fail to take into account that data about a company can change frequently. Some people forget to check the timestamp of the data they are using, potentially rely on outdated details. It is essential to make use of a trustworthy and current source to ensure the information retrieved in an Limited Liability Company business search is up-to-date and accurate, thereby preventing incorrect choices.
